Transaction 01507811e772fb79800e840b4d30fe29608d5560f98e8fe790fdd0e76607d0f1

1 Input
2 Outputs
  • 01507811e772fb79800e840b4d30fe29608d5560f98e8fe790fdd0e76607d0f1:0
  • value  990000
    address  3FGx1eCd4WD731ijySW1cFQ3uiSmLighpS
  • 01507811e772fb79800e840b4d30fe29608d5560f98e8fe790fdd0e76607d0f1:1
  • value  139874854
    address  1H6HHY7kcKcwhTo8t99r8gBoJyi11NXEKb